Fans of Taylor Swift can look forward to October 3. In the podcast of her friend Travis Kelce, the star reveals more about their new album – and both show their feelings very openly for each other.
US pop megastar Taylor Swift has shed a few tears in the “New Heights” podcast “New Heights” of her friend Travis Kelce, showed feelings-and above all reveal more about her new album. The twelfth studio album entitled “The Life of A Showgirl” is scheduled to appear on October 3. While she was traveling in Europe with her “Eras Tour”, she worked on the album, Swift said in the podcast of the football player published on Wednesday evening (local time), which he had together with his brother Jason Kelce.
That was very exhausting, but she was “mentally stimulated” and was fully with creative energy. She “literally lived the life of a show girl,” said the megastar.
With loud cheers and clapping of the brothers, Swift pulled the new album out of a suitcase when she appeared. On the cover, she covers in a glitter outfit in turquoise water. The title sparkles in orange-red writing. Further photos of the album show the singer in spring and glittering costumes and a lot of bare skin.
The singer also posted the album cover on her social media. The album has 12 tracks, including titles such as “Elizabeth Taylor”, “Eldest Daughter” and “Honey”. Sabrina Carpenter participates in the song “The Life of a Show Girl”. For the recordings, Swift teamed up with the Swedish producer legends Max Martin and Shellback, with which she had previously worked on albums like “Red” or “Reputation”.
Taylor had already announced the new album with a countdown on August 12th – twelve minutes after midnight – on the website Taylorswift.com, which experienced a big rush. At the same time, she posted a teaservide for the podcast episode on social media.
Swift and Kelce flirt in the podcast
Popstar Swift and the Kansas City Chiefs player Kelce officially made their love in the summer of 2023. Since then, both have been part of the public regularly, but for the first time the megastar has now been a guest in the podcast. The two now also used the joint appearance for numerous flirt moments.
He had experienced Swift in 2023 on stage for the first time on the “Eras” tour and was completely fascinated and so much wanted to get to know her, revealed Travis Kelce in the podcast. On stage, the singer would drive an entire stadium crazy, but privately, alone in one room, he was able to talk to her naturally and easily. At the personal meeting she was “so real and so beautiful”, the football star enthused. She would make him so much better. Taylor thanked him visibly moved for the compliments. Holding hands and also Kissend the couple did not hold back with expressions of love.
Swift moved to tears
In tears, Swift spoke about her great efforts to buy back the rights to her first six albums. That was recently succeeded in the singer with her former manager and label after a year -long argument. She cried snot and water when she was able to buy the rights of the investment company Shamrock Capital in Los Angeles again, said Swift. These songs are like a handwritten diary, from every phase of your life. This was a real matter of the heart.
Elevenes album set several records
Swift ended her monumental “Eras Tour” in December 2024. The concert series, which began in March 2023, played around $ 2 billion (around $ 1.9 billion) with more than ten million tickets sold, which makes it the most sales -strong tour of history. Her eleventh studio album “The Tortured Poets Department: The Anthology” was released in April 2024 and was the global most streaming album of 2024 on Spotify. On the streaming platform and in the German charts, Swift set several records with the album shortly after appearance.
